Understanding Patio Glass Damage
Before diving into the repair procedure, it's vital to comprehend the types of damage that can happen. Typical issues consist of:
- Cracks and Chips: These can be brought on by effect from particles, unexpected bumps, or temperature level changes.
- Fogging: This happens when the seal in between double-pane glass fails, allowing moisture to enter and mist up the glass.
- Breaks: Larger breaks can be harmful and need immediate attention.
- Use and Tear: Over time, the hardware and seals around the glass can deteriorate, resulting in leaks and drafts.
Steps to Take When You Notice Damage
- Assess the Damage: Determine the degree of the damage. Little cracks and chips may be repairable, while bigger breaks often require replacement.
- Security First: If the glass is broken, guarantee that the area is safe. Use gloves and protective eyeglasses to prevent injury.
- File the Damage: Take pictures and keep in mind the dimensions of the damaged area. This info will work when calling a repair service.
- Temporary Solutions: If the damage is small, you can utilize clear tape to momentarily hold the glass in location. For bigger breaks, cover the area with a tarpaulin to avoid additional damage and ensure security.

What to Expect During the Repair Process
- Preliminary Consultation: A service technician will visit your home to examine the damage and offer an in-depth quote. This is a great time to ask any questions you may have.
- Preparation: The professional will prepare the area, removing any broken glass and cleaning up the frame.
- Repair or Replacement: Depending on the level of the damage, the technician will either repair the glass or replace it. For misted double-pane glass, the professional might need to replace the whole unit.
- Final Inspection: Once the repair is complete, the professional will check the work to ensure it fulfills quality standards. They will also clean up the location and remove any debris.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does patio glass repair cost?A: The cost of patio glass repair can differ depending upon the extent of the damage and the kind of glass. Small repairs like chips and small cracks can cost in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150, while bigger breaks or replacements can v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500 or more.
Q: Can I repair a broken patio glass myself?A: Small chips and cracks can sometimes be fixed with DIY kits, but it's normally recommended to work with an expert for bigger cracks or breaks to make sure security and quality.
Q: How long does patio glass repair take?A: The repair procedure can take anywhere from a few hours to a number of days, depending on the intricacy of the task. Easy repairs can typically be finished in a single go to.
